Understanding the Terra Ecosystem

For those new to the scene, let's quickly recap what Terra and Luna were all about. The Terra ecosystem was designed to offer stablecoins, like the infamous UST, which were meant to be pegged to the US dollar. This stability was achieved through a complex algorithmic mechanism involving the LUNA token. When UST deviated from its peg, users could burn UST to mint LUNA, and vice-versa. This arbitrage mechanism was supposed to keep UST stable. However, during the de-peg event, this mechanism spiraled out of control, leading to hyperinflation of LUNA and the collapse of UST's value. The Luna Foundation Guard (LFG), which was meant to safeguard UST's peg, also came under intense scrutiny. Understanding this core mechanism is key to grasping the luna terra news and the subsequent events. The goal of Terra 2.0 was to move away from the algorithmic stablecoin model that proved so vulnerable, focusing instead on a more traditional approach with collateralized stablecoins or other mechanisms. The Impact of the Collapse

The Luna Terra crash wasn't just a localized event; it sent shockwaves throughout the entire cryptocurrency market. It highlighted the risks associated with algorithmic stablecoins and led to increased regulatory scrutiny worldwide. Many investors lost significant amounts of money, leading to widespread disillusionment and calls for greater transparency and accountability in the crypto space. The events surrounding Terra also prompted many projects to re-evaluate their own stablecoin designs and risk management strategies. It was a harsh reminder that even innovative technologies carry inherent risks, and that robust security and well-thought-out economic models are paramount. Regulators globally took notice, accelerating discussions around stablecoin regulations and consumer protection.
